Note: Out-of-meter-coupling-range warning
If the subject is too bright or too dark, the viewfinder
indication blinks to warn of extraordinary lighting
conditions.
If the blinking goes off after turning the aperture ring
either to a smaller aperture (toward a larger f-number
such as f/22) or to a larger one (toward a smaller
f-number such as f/1.4), you are ready to shoot.
• If a correct exposure cannot be obtained by turning the
aperture ring, select another shutter speed.
• If a correct exposure cannot be obtained by shifting the
shutter speed, select another aperture.
